         <title>1803: Modelo Atômico de Dalton</title>
         <author>mozao2019cej</author>
         <link>https://padlet.com/mozao2019cej/aa1ay7cj0hwvkkuq/wish/2943811888</link>
         <description><![CDATA[John Dalton propôs que a matéria é feita de átomos indestrutíveis, onde cada elemento químico consiste de átomos de um único tipo, indivisíveis e inalteráveis.]]></description>

         <title>1897: Descoberta do Elétron - J.J. Thomson</title>
         <author>mozao2019cej</author>
         <link>https://padlet.com/mozao2019cej/aa1ay7cj0hwvkkuq/wish/2943811889</link>
         <description><![CDATA[J.J. Thomson, através de seus experimentos com raios catódicos, descobriu a existência do elétron, uma partícula subatômica com carga negativa, o que levou ao desenvolvimento de seu modelo atômico, sugerindo que os átomos eram divisíveis e constituídos de elétrons inseridos numa esfera de carga positiva.]]></description>

         <title>1911: Modelo Atômico de Rutherford</title>
         <author>mozao2019cej</author>
         <link>https://padlet.com/mozao2019cej/aa1ay7cj0hwvkkuq/wish/2943811890</link>
         <description><![CDATA[Ernest Rutherford, através de sua famosa experiência de espalhamento de partículas alfa, concluiu que os átomos têm um núcleo denso e carregado positivamente, com os elétrons orbitando ao redor deste núcleo a grandes distâncias. Isso desafiou a ideia de um 'pudim de ameixa' de Thomson.]]></description>

         <title>1913: Modelo Atômico de Bohr</title>
         <author>mozao2019cej</author>
         <link>https://padlet.com/mozao2019cej/aa1ay7cj0hwvkkuq/wish/2943811892</link>
         <description><![CDATA[Niels Bohr combinou as ideias de Rutherford com as teorias quânticas para propor um modelo atômico onde os elétrons orbitam o núcleo em órbitas fixas sem irradiar energia, a menos que mudem de órbita. Esse modelo foi fundamental para entender a estrutura do átomo.]]></description>

         <title>1926: Mecânica Quântica e o Modelo Atômico de Schrödinger</title>
         <author>mozao2019cej</author>
         <link>https://padlet.com/mozao2019cej/aa1ay7cj0hwvkkuq/wish/2943811893</link>
         <description><![CDATA[Erwin Schrödinger desenvolveu a equação de onda que dá base à mecânica quântica, sugerindo que os elétrons não ocupam órbitas definidas, mas sim, existem em 'nuvens de probabilidade' ao redor do núcleo, o que foi um avanço significativo no entendimento da estrutura atômica.]]></description>

         <title>1932: Descoberta do Nêutron por James Chadwick</title>
         <author>mozao2019cej</author>
         <link>https://padlet.com/mozao2019cej/aa1ay7cj0hwvkkuq/wish/2943811894</link>
         <description><![CDATA[James Chadwick descobriu o nêutron, uma partícula no núcleo atômico sem carga elétrica, o que foi crucial para o desenvolvimento da física nuclear e para a compreensão da composição e estabilidade dos núcleos atômicos.]]></description>
